Skip to content

sevbanBayir/Charts

 
 

Repository files navigation

logo-no-background

Charts

Release Build Status

This is a simple chart library built with Jetpack Compose.

Inspired by: https://github.com/AppPear/ChartView

Screenshot 2024-02-03 at 21 21 37

Documentation

Public API: https://dautovicharis.github.io/Charts/

Generate documentation
./gradlew dokkaHtml

Features

  • Animations
  • M3 theme support
  • Customizable chart styles
  • Various data set support

Instalation

Step 1. Add the JitPack repository to your build file

Add it in your settings.gradle.kts at the end of repositories:

    dependencyResolutionManagement {
        rep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S)
        repositories {
            google()
            mavenCentral()
            maven(url = "https://jitpack.io")
        }
    }

Step 2. Add the dependency

    implementation("com.github.dautovicharis:Charts:{version}")

Supported charts

Pie

ezgif com-optimize (1)

Line

line-curve-merged line-merged

Bar

bar-chart

Stacked Bar

stacked-bar-merged

Examples

Contributions

🌟 Thank you for your time! Before you start working on code, please create a new issue.

Contributing guidelines

About

Charts made in JetpackCompose

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Languages

  • Kotlin 100.0%